How you will make an impact as a Property Manager at haart Estate Agents in Bristol:
  • Booking and conducting property inspections
  • Negotiating tenancy extensions and/or renewals
  • Co ordinating with contractors, to manage maintenance and/or repair issues at properties
  • Deposit returns
  • Resolving rental arrears
  • Processing eviction requests
  • Ensuring properties meet all regulatory health and safety standards
  • Building and maintaining strong relationships with landlords and tenants
  • Managing complaints
  • Completing all check in and check out procedures, inc. full inventory reports
